I'm going to give a little sneak peak of the fic I'm writing for @darkchocola who won my little writing giveaway.
This time, a clear emotion spread across Solas' face. Casssandra had hit a nerve, and she didn’t know whether to celebrate this small victory or fear it and his reaction to it. But as Cassandra stared at him, standing defiant and trying her best to keep to the plan, she saw what it was there beneath his stoic mask. Grief. Solas looked away from her then, only for a moment, his jaw tightening faintly before he spoke again. “Happy?” he responded, his voice taking a dangerous dip as he turned his now-hardened violet eyes on her - eyes that had only moments before been filled with pain. “Do not presume what I should or should not feel. I did what was necessary. Yes, it was cruel, I will not deny that, but everything I have done is to ensure she is safe. Whether that is from this world or from me. And because...” He paused as Cassandra noted another shift in his eyes, as though he were seeing into a distant future she herself couldn't. “... someone like her would have been greatly needed,” he continued, almost wistfully, “in the world that I will restore.”
I've really been enjoying writing this and the will of its own it seems to have - writing Aina has been inspiring.
